首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何访问laravel集合中的属性值

在Laravel中,可以通过使用集合对象的pluck方法来访问集合中的属性值。pluck方法接受一个属性名称作为参数,并返回一个包含指定属性值的新集合。

以下是访问Laravel集合中属性值的步骤:

  1. 首先,确保你已经获取到一个集合对象。如果你从数据库查询中获得的结果是一个Eloquent集合,则可以直接使用它。如果你有一个数组,你可以使用collect函数将其转换为集合。例如:
代码语言:txt
复制
$users = collect([
    ['name' => 'John', 'age' => 25],
    ['name' => 'Jane', 'age' => 30],
    ['name' => 'Dave', 'age' => 35],
]);
  1. 使用pluck方法来访问属性值。在参数中传入你想获取的属性名称。例如,要获取所有用户的姓名,可以这样做:
代码语言:txt
复制
$names = $users->pluck('name');

$names将包含一个新的集合,其中包含'John''Jane''Dave'

  1. 如果你只想获取唯一的属性值,可以使用unique方法。例如,要获取所有不重复的年龄,可以这样做:
代码语言:txt
复制
$uniqueAges = $users->pluck('age')->unique();

$uniqueAges将包含一个新的集合,其中只包含253035

综上所述,通过使用pluck方法,可以轻松地访问Laravel集合中的属性值。

在腾讯云中,提供了强大的云计算平台和相关产品,适用于各种应用场景。作为云计算领域的专家,你可以推荐使用腾讯云的云服务器CVM作为基础设施支持,并且可以使用云数据库MySQL作为数据存储解决方案。此外,你还可以推荐使用腾讯云函数SCF来构建无服务器应用,并使用腾讯云CDN加速内容分发。

以下是腾讯云产品的相关链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

16分48秒

第 6 章 算法链与管道(2)

2分54秒

Elastic 5 分钟教程:Kibana入门

5分40秒

如何使用ArcScript中的格式化器

7分19秒

085.go的map的基本使用

1分21秒

11、mysql系列之许可更新及对象搜索

1时29分

企业出海秘籍:如何以「稳定」产品提升留存,以AIGC「创新」实现全球增长?

2分7秒

使用NineData管理和修改ClickHouse数据库

2分52秒

如何使用 Docker Extensions,以 NebulaGraph 为例

6分6秒

普通人如何理解递归算法

2分33秒

SuperEdge易学易用系列-如何借助tunnel登录和运维边缘节点

2分23秒

如何从通县进入虚拟世界

793
2分7秒

基于深度强化学习的机械臂位置感知抓取任务

领券